It’s a true reflection of Goan public life, offering a dynamic space for recreation, socializing, and witnessing the daily spectacle of the sunset with neighbors and friends.","family":null,"party":null,"diver":null,"explorer":null},"faqs":[{"a":"Colva Beach is generally safe for swimming, with relatively calm waters. It's a popular public beach, and lifeguards are usually present during the peak season. However, always be mindful of your surroundings, especially if the beach is crowded. Avoid swimming after dark or under the influence of alcohol, and keep a close watch on children. Heed any warning flags or instructions from lifeguards.","q":"Is Colva Beach safe for swimming, and what are the general safety guidelines?"},{"a":"The best time to visit Colva Beach is from October to March. During these months, the weather is dry, sunny, and pleasant, perfect for enjoying the beach and its vibrant atmosphere. This period also coincides with the peak tourist season, ensuring a lively environment with plenty of activities and events. The monsoon season (June-September) should be avoided for beach activities.","q":"What is the best time to visit Colva Beach for good weather and a lively atmosphere?"},{"a":"Colva Beach is very accessible, being South Goa's most famous public beach. From Margao, it's a short taxi or auto-rickshaw ride. Local buses also run frequently to Colva. Many hotels and guesthouses in the area offer pick-up services. If you're driving, there's usually parking available, though it can get busy.
